Not at all. A partner checklist is a handy tool for people thinking about adding some bdsm and/or D/s play to their lives. It's a great starting point, wherein you can both explore fantasies by comparing likes, dislikes, curiosities, etc. Here's a link to one that can be saved and re-posted back here. *wink*

On the 0-5 scale, it's easiest if you think of it as follows:

0 - Hard Limit. Absolutely not.
1 - If you're really into it, we can discuss it. But I'd really rather not.
2 - Curious but dubious.
3 - Enticing idea.
4 - I like this.
5 - I love this.
